Seasonal Damage Patterns in Elm Grove
Understanding seasonal damage patterns helps Elm Grove residents prepare for and recognize potential restoration needs throughout the year.
Spring (March-May):
- Peak water damage from snowmelt and heavy rains
- Basement flooding incidents increase significantly
- Sewage backup risks rise with storm water overflow
Summer (June-August):
- Severe thunderstorm water damage
- Mold growth accelerates in humid conditions
- Lightning-related fire damage peaks
Fall (September-November):
- Chimney and fireplace smoke damage begins
- Leaf accumulation creates drainage issues
- Early heating system malfunctions
Winter (December-February):
- Fire damage incidents from heating equipment
- Smoke damage from fireplace overuse
- Frozen pipe bursts causing water damage
- Ice dam formation leading to roof leaks
Each season requires different prevention strategies and response protocols to minimize damage and restoration costs.
Housing Characteristics & Restoration Considerations
Elm Grove's housing stock reflects the village's development history, with many homes built between 1950-1980 featuring specific construction characteristics that impact restoration approaches. These mid-century homes often include finished basements, brick exteriors, and original plumbing systems that require specialized attention during restoration projects.
Common construction features affecting restoration:
- Concrete block foundations - Susceptible to water penetration and require specific waterproofing techniques
- Hardwood flooring - Requires careful drying procedures to prevent warping during water damage restoration
- Plaster walls - Need specialized cleaning methods for smoke damage restoration
- Original electrical systems - May require updates during fire damage restoration
- Finished basements - Create hidden spaces where mold can develop undetected
Newer construction in Elm Grove typically features:
- Improved foundation waterproofing systems
- Modern HVAC systems that aid in moisture control
- Updated electrical codes reducing fire risks
- Better insulation affecting smoke damage patterns
Understanding these construction differences allows restoration professionals to select appropriate techniques and materials for each property type. Older homes may require additional structural assessments, while newer homes often have better moisture barriers that can complicate water extraction if not properly addressed.
Environmental Conditions & Damage Implications
Elm Grove's continental climate and geographic location create specific environmental conditions that directly impact damage restoration needs and timelines. The village experiences significant seasonal temperature variations and humidity fluctuations that affect how different types of damage develop and spread.
Climate factors affecting restoration:
- Average annual precipitation: 34 inches creates consistent moisture challenges
- Humidity levels: Summer highs near 75% accelerate mold growth
- Temperature extremes: -10°F to 85°F range affects material expansion and contraction
- Soil composition: Clay-rich soils retain water and increase basement flooding risks
Specific environmental impacts on restoration services:
- Water damage: Clay soils create hydrostatic pressure against foundations
- Sewage cleanup: Heavy rains overwhelm aging sewer infrastructure
- Fire damage: Dry winter air increases fire spread rates
- Smoke damage: Temperature inversions trap smoke particles longer
- Mold removal: High summer humidity creates ideal growth conditions
The Root River's proximity adds another environmental factor, as seasonal flooding can affect groundwater levels and basement moisture throughout the village. Professional restoration services must account for these ongoing environmental pressures when developing drying strategies and prevention recommendations for Elm Grove properties.
